--- title: AI Time Machine sdk: gradio sdk_version: 6.17.3 python_version: 3.12 app_file: app.py fullWidth: true tags: - track:wood - sponsor:openai - sponsor:nvidia - sponsor:modal - achievement:offbrand - achievement:fieldnotes --- # AI Time Machine AI Time Machine is an immersive Gradio experience for the Build Small Hackathon. The user launches a time machine, arrives in a generated scene, meets an ordinary person from that time and place, talks with them by text or voice, and brings back a souvenir from the encounter. This is built for the **Thousand Token Wood** track: the product is a playful, AI-native encounter rather than a conventional chatbot. Pick a launch mode: surprise, past, or future. 2. Start the portal sequence while the app creates the destination, persona, visual scene, narration, and character context. 3. Interact with the person you meet through text or live voice. 4. Ask for a souvenir and reveal a generated artifact from the encounter.
